NORTHAMPTON, Mass. – Sophomore
Abigail Karalus scored the game-winning goal 12 minutes into the first quarter to propel the Nichols College field hockey team to a 3-1 win over Westfield State Sunday morning at the Caryl Newof Classic.
Graduate student
Dana Edwards and junior
Mackenzie Doran also found the back of the cage for the Bison, who opened the season 2-1 for the second time in three years. Freshman goalie
Sophia Venable turned aside seven shots to record her second collegiate win as NC improved to 4-2 all-time against Westfield State.
Nichols – which held a 9-4 edge in penalty corners – build a 3-0 lead as it scored three times in the first 18:08 of the contest. The Owls finally got on the board at the 57:59 mark but got no closer. Both teams fired off 10 shots.
